We are a transdisciplinary team that consists of Occupational Therapy, Speech Pathology, and Physiotherapy, who are passionate about supporting children with disabilities to have a good quality of life. We are committed to person-centred. practice and support positive changes for individuals and their families. We work closely with parents, caregivers, teachers and support staff, to address individual goals and promote growth and development. We are a community-based service provider, which means that we visit you and/or your child in natural settings i.e. home, day care, school and other community locations. Our community-based approach is best practice in targeting goals within the child's natural environment, routines and relationships. We provide services to children living with a disability and their families in the north-central metropolitan region of Perth.
